SmartrFlow allows firms to automate their case workflows in Smartr365 – Adviser Portal by defining mandatory tasks that must be completed at each status before a case can progress. This guide provides a step-by-step walkthrough of how to set up, manage and publish these tasks, as well as frequently asked questions.

Step 1: Access SmartrFlow

  1. Navigate to Settings in the left-hand menu.

  1. Click SmartrFlow (Beta).

You will land on the SmartrFlow dashboard where you can manage workflows for:

  • Residential mortgages

  • Buy to let mortgages

Click Edit (to update an existing workflow) or Create Workflow to begin.

Step 2: Select a Template

You will be prompted to select from two options:

Option 1 – Ready to Go (Recommended)

  • Loads a standard workflow template built by Smartr365 – SmartrFlow.

  • Pre-populates each status with a set of predefined tasks based on industry best practice.

Option 2 – Build Your Own Template

  • Loads a blank canvas.

  • You will manually add each status and define the tasks associated with them.

Step 3: Review or Build Workflow Statuses

Your workflow will be displayed as a series of horizontal statuses (e.g. New Lead, Callback, Decision in Principle).

From this screen, you can:

  • Add new statuses

  • Remove or rename existing statuses

  • Click the green plus (+) icon under each status to add tasks

Step 4: Add Tasks to a Workflow Status

Clicking the green plus opens a modal where you can manage tasks.

You now have two options:

  1. Select from predefined tasks – from the centralised SmartrFlow task library

  1. Create your own task – completely custom to your firm

Each task requires the following:

Field

Description

Title

Name of the task as it appears in the workflow

Description

(Optional) Additional notes for the task

Assign Role

Mandatory – defines who can action the task

SLA (Working Days)

Mandatory – deadline for task completion

Auto-Assign

If enabled, the task will automatically be assigned to a user in the selected role

Valid Roles:

  • System Administrator

  • Admin Assistant

  • Manager

  • Mortgage Adviser

  • Protection Adviser

Once added, tasks will appear below each status in green. You can:

  • Edit tasks

  • Delete tasks

  • Add more tasks

Step 5: Publish the Workflow

Once all tasks have been added to the relevant workflow statuses:

  1. Click Publish

  1. A confirmation screen will appear

  1. Click Continue

Publishing a workflow means:

  • Any new cases created from this point onwards will follow this structure.

  • Users must complete all mandatory tasks at a given status before the case can move forward.

e.g. If "Send introduction email" is added to the New Lead status, it must be marked complete before advancing.

Step 6: Managing Your Workflow

From the SmartrFlow landing page, you can:

  • Click Edit to change the current workflow

  • Click Unpublish to turn it off (removes mandatory tasks from new cases)

Unpublishing does not affect cases already created under a published workflow only new ones.
